Subject: Loyalty programme overhaul — handover notes

Team,

As Dalia Renwick steps into the director role next month, here is the current state of the Cresta Rewards overhaul. Enrolment has stalled at 38% of active customers, and redemption costs are running 12% over plan. We intend to collapse the three tiers into two and shift points accrual toward the Bramleigh card. Dalia will own the migration timeline from day one. For her eyes, the strategic context is as follows:

board note of bajop-yaweg: The western region missed its Pelys quota by 58.0 percent last quarter. Pelysek Foods plans to raise the Belius list price by 44.0 percent in July. The steering committee signed off on a budget of $133.8 million for Project Pelax. The renewal with Zoraelix Systems closes at $61.9 million a year, 12.7 percent above the last contract.

// HEADS UP, on-call friend: this constant caps heap size for the
// Pairwise matching service. We learned the hard way that anything
// above 12 GB triggers multi-second GC pauses during peak matching,
// and riders on Bramblehop start timing out. Don't raise it without
// load-testing on the Kestrel staging rig first. If you see pause
// spikes, roll back to the last known-good build, whose token is
// pinned just below.

build token for kagaf-hahof: htk14_9d3d4d26d7d8de

### Step 4: Move waveform previews to WaveCrate

Okay, this one's mostly mechanical. The old Tonemark service rendered waveform PNGs on request; WaveCrate precomputes peaks at upload time and stores them as JSON blobs. Delete the render queue consumer, keep the upload hook, and backfill existing tracks with the `crate-backfill` script (takes ~40 min on staging). Double-check that the peaks table has the new `sample_rate` column before running anything. The backfill script reads the peaks database using the connection string below.

replica DSN, yahaf-yagaf: mongodb://tamath_svc:a2netSk3RZMuTj@db-d084.novacsoft.internal:5432/ralmir